The service was mostly terrible. My husband and I booked the room because we were going to be in town for a concert. We checked in at 4:30pm. We went to the room to check the cleanliness...all checked out ok less a pair or dirty balled up panties in a dresser drawer. We made plans to have it removed, but never got around to it due to the chaos that ensued after. We went down to our car to grab our bags. When we got back to our room, our keys wouldn't work. We lugged our bags back down to the front desk and we were told that the keys we deactivated because we kept them too close to our cell phones. We got new keys, went back to the room, but the new keys still didn't work. My husband went back down while I waited to outside the room. He asked for a new room, but got a third set of keys instead. Low and behold, those keys didn't work either. Maintenance came, manually unlocked our door with a contraption so I could get my purse with the concert tickets. We were super late to the show, which makes me that much more angry... cause that whole ordeal took an hour and a half. We were told that when we got back, all we would have to do is get a new set of keys from the front desk because they needed to change the battery and reprogram the door. We got back at around 12:30/1:00 am explain our situation to the front desk, they had no idea what we were talking about... gave us new keys. Low and behold the new keys didn't work. It wasn't until then, that they were willing to give us a new room.. we didn't take it. We opted to drive the 3 hours home, instead. Never did get to tell them about the dirty panties...
